ALL.

SPACE, has developed a smart terminal, capable of linking with all satellites, all networks, in all orbits, all at once.

Our ground-breaking software-defined service enablement platform integrates intelligent routing, edge computing and on-demand services to deliver unprecedented network resilience and application performance.

Our terminal designs operate as fully electronic beam steering systems.

Our IP has applications across a wide range of market sectors including aeronautical, land mobile, maritime, and 5G.

It provides broadband, multi-beam, two-way communications with dynamic tracking of geostationary and non-geostationary satellites or terrestrial nodes.

All. Space is transforming satellite communications with next-generation smart terminal technology. We are seeking a

High-Speed Digital Design Engineer to help deliver advanced digital hardware solutions for our satellite communications platforms.

This role will contribute to the design, simulation, and validation of high-performance electronics that enable resilient, high-bandwidth connectivity for government, defence, and commercial customers worldwide.

This role offers a great opportunity to work on cutting-edge technologies for satellite communications and contribute to the advancement of the next generation of All Space terminals.

Key Responsibilities

  • Designing high speed digital Printed Circuit Boards that utilise the latest FPGA, microprocessor and high-speed interconnect technologies.
  • Design and validate multi-gigabit Ser Des links (e. g., JESD204B/C, PCIe, Ethernet) for system interconnects.
  • Perform signal integrity (SI) and power integrity (PI) analysis to ensure robustness under extreme operating conditions.
  • Collaborate with RF, antenna, and system engineering teams to optimise RF/digital co-design for phased array terminals.
  • Conduct hardware bring-up, debugging, and validation using oscilloscopes, logic analysers, and high-speed test equipment.
  • Support system-level integration of digital hardware with firmware, embedded software, and mechanical designs.
  • Provide technical documentation and contribute to design reviews throughout the development lifecycle.
  • Degree (BSc, BEng or higher) in Electrical / Electronic Engineering or related discipline (Physics, etc.).
  • Knowledge of FPGA design / implementation (Xilinx / Intel / similar).
  • Knowledge of high-speed Ser Des / transceiver links (e. g. PCIe, Ethernet, JESD, or similar).
  • Knowledge of high-speed digital design: signal integrity, power integrity, timing closure, board layout for fast edges.
  • Schematic capture and PCB design tools(Altium preferred); experience driving the full hardware lifecycle: requirements, design, test, integration.
  • Experience doing hardware, firmware, and software integration on microprocessor-based platforms.
  • Good debugging, verification, and lab test skills.
